Aracari sponsors football team from Huayllabamba community

Responsible Travel Peru: Aracari sponsors Soccer team

In line with our commitment to supporting communities in Peru, Aracari is sponsoring a football (soccer) team from the community of Huayllabamba in the Cusco region.

Libio – the chef for our adventure, trekking and camping trips – hails from the community, along with some of our trekking porters, and so we decided to provide some snazzy new football strips for their local team.

Let’s hope the new look sends them to the top of the league!
